Flu vaccines are perfectly safe for healthy adults unless you are allergic to eggs. They only include 3 strains in the shot each year. If you are getting a flu shot and still getting sick you either a. got a really bad cold or b. got a strain of flu not included in the shot. Again, there are tests they can do to find out if you actually have flu and which strain. I didn't get my flu shot this year and I didn't get sick. I also stopped working at a middle school in July. Gee... I wonder which one it was :D I haven't actually had INFLUENZA since I've been getting my shots (for like 10 years, they lined us up in the college dorms and stuck us!) I did have a really bad cold last year that I thought was the flu, but it was not (I got a swab test and I got better in 4 days). The flu lasts for like TWO WEEKS. If you get a cold it lasts a few days with maybe 1 or 2 really bad days. If you have the flu there should be no mistaking it :)

It makes total sense. Individuals do not know if they have the flu, let alone the swine flu. Just look at this thread at how many people are confusing a stomach virus for influenza. They want you to call and find out what to do. Personally, I would call MY doctor first but not everyone has a doctor so they have hotlines set up. If they think you have the flu they will take you into isolation and use extra precaution to make sure you don't infect others. People go to the ER when they are sick if they do not have regular doctors or health insurance and they don't want people in the ER unless it is an emergency. They don't want people to panic and flood ERs. You need to get anti-virals within 48 hours of onset of symptoms...plenty of time to call first.

If it's a true emergency of course go to the ER, but they don't want people with mild symptoms sitting in the ER waiting room infecting other people.
